Job SummaryThe Welding / Quality Engineer is responsible for ensuring all welding operations meet the highest standards of quality, safety, and regulatory compliance across a U.S.
-based manufacturing facility and supporting global plants. This role serves as the technical authority for welding processes, welder qualification, and metallurgical problem-solving, while driving continuous improvement in welding technologies and quality systems.
This position works closely with Production Engineering, Quality, and OEM customers to ensure compliance with AWS, ISO 3834-2, and ISO 9001 standards. The role plays a critical part in OEM readiness, structured problem-solving, and maintaining consistent welding quality across multiple sites.
Key Responsibilities- Develop, maintain, and control Welding Procedure Specifications (WPS) in compliance with AWS and ISO 3834-2 standards.
- Oversee welder qualification and certification processes, ensuring ongoing compliance with applicable codes and standards.
- Provide technical leadership and welding process support across multiple manufacturing plants.
- Analyze welding, metallurgical, and fabrication issues using root cause analysis and implement corrective actions.
- Supervise and audit welding operations to ensure adherence to approved procedures and quality expectations.
- Partner with Quality and Engineering teams to maintain ISO 9001 and ISO 3834-2 compliance.
- Lead OEM readiness activities including APQP, PPAP, dimensional validation, and process capability studies.
- Manage OEM claims using structured problem-solving methodologies such as 8D, A3, and 5 Whys.
- Monitor and improve internal process quality using SPC, PFMEA, and real-time quality dashboards.
